Planning permit activity in Merricks
Real application data for Merricks from the Victorian state planning permit register (PPARS) — records back to 2007. Local decisions are the best guide to what Mornington Peninsula Shire actually supports here.
232
applications on record
78
permits issued
27
new dwellings proposed
88%
of recorded outcomes got a permit
| Year | 2022 | 2021 | 2020 | 2019 | 2018 |
|---|---|---|---|---|---|
| Applications | 2 | 8 | 18 | 12 | 12 |
Source: Victorian state planning permit register (PPARS), records to mid-2023. Council participation varies by year; figures are indicative. “No permit issued” outcomes include withdrawn and lapsed applications, not only refusals.

Frequently Asked Questions
How many planning permits have been approved in Merricks?
The Victorian state permit register (PPARS) records 232 planning permit applications in Merricks since 2007, with 78 permits issued and 27 new dwellings proposed across all applications. The register's public extract runs to mid-2023; recent local decisions are a strong guide to what Mornington Peninsula Shire supports in Merricks.

What planning zone is Merricks in?
Properties in Merricks are commonly located in the General Residential Zone (GRZ), Neighbourhood Residential Zone (NRZ), Low Density Residential Zone (LDRZ), Green Wedge Zone (GWZ). The exact zone for your property depends on its specific location within Merricks. You can check your property's zone using VicPlan or our free Property Snapshot tool.

How do I find my property's planning zone?
You can find your property's planning zone by searching your address on VicPlan, the official Victoria planning map. It shows the zone, overlays, and other planning controls that apply to any property in Victoria.
